Sobre el Autor

Sobre el autor de Las reglas del cerebro para envejecer bien

John J. Medina es el autor superventas del New York Times de Brain Rules for Aging Well: 10 Principles for Staying Vital, Happy, and Sharp (Normas del cerebro para envejecer bien: 10 principios para mantenerse vital, feliz y lúcido). Es un biólogo molecular del desarrollo reconocido por hacer que la ciencia del cerebro sea accesible para el gran público.

Como investigador, profesor y consultor, Medina se especializa en traducir la neurociencia compleja en estrategias prácticas para optimizar la salud cerebral en todas las etapas de la vida. Su innovadora serie Brain Rules —que incluye Brain Rules: 12 Principles for Surviving and Thriving at Work, Home, and School y Brain Rules for Baby— ha sido traducida a más de 20 idiomas y adoptada como libro de texto en universidades de todo el mundo.

Medina es el director fundador del Talaris Research Institute y profesor afiliado de bioingeniería en la Facultad de Medicina de la Universidad de Washington. Combina el rigor académico con aplicaciones del mundo real, asesorando a sistemas de salud y empresas de la lista Fortune 500 sobre prácticas favorables para el cerebro.

Conocido por sus dinámicas charlas TED y sus apariciones en medios como NPR y en The Psychiatric Times, el trabajo de Medina ha dado forma a las conversaciones globales sobre la salud cognitiva. La serie Brain Rules ha vendido millones de copias, y con Brain Rules for Aging Well extiende su legado de empoderar a los lectores para aprovechar la neurociencia en favor de una vitalidad de por vida.
